Huch, Gerald Norman God relieved Gerald Norman Huch from years of pain, as he passed peacefully in his sleep on August 27, 2016, at his home in St. Louis.

A friend to all and beloved husband of Mary J. Huch (née Alvis); father of Elias and Jamie (Schenker) and Shane Huch; grandfather to Ross, Trent, Payton and Meleah; brother to Larry (Tiz), Norm (Stacy) Huch and Judy Savage (Larry); son of Ina Nuderscher and the late Norman Gerald Huch.

Known to all as “Jerry” he proudly served his country in the U.S. Air Force, serving two terms in the Vietnam War.

He had a masters degree in education, was an entrepreneur and gifted salesman.  Many considered him “the life of the party”.  He will be forever missed.

Services: Funeral at KUTIS AFFTON Chapel, 10151 Gravois, Friday, September 2, 2016, 10 a.m. Interment J.B. National Cemetery. Visitation Thursday, 4-9 p.m.
